You might easily walk past this branch of the ubiquitous Costa Coffee, but that's also part of its appeal to me.
It feels a bit tucked away and you might not notice as you hurry past for a bus, but it has those great floor to ceiling windows which you can peer out of over an Americano or cappucino. The coffee is like it is in most other Costas, which I do happen to like, but what I like is being able to hide away in the shadows at the back, which other people may find a little too shadowy and lacking in light. But it's a great way to step out of the hubbub of the Triangle.
